Understanding the Role of Demolition Experts

Demolition might sound straightforward, but it's a specialised field that requires significant expertise and coordination. Professional demolition experts work closely with construction professionals, architects, and engineers to ensure that all demolitions are conducted safely and efficiently. They should follow local and national building codes, ensuring their work complies with all legal standards. This adherence aims to guarantee that the demolition process does not cause any unintended harm to surrounding structures or go against building regulations.

Permits and Legal Compliance

In New Zealand, obtaining the necessary permits is an essential step before any demolition can take place. Typically, the demolition company handles this aspect, liaising with local authorities to ensure all legal requirements are met. This can be particularly crucial in a city like Wellington, with its unique architectural history and strict building codes shaped by its seismic activity. Ensuring all permits are in place aims to keep the project legal and prevent any delays or additional costs that could arise from non-compliance.

Weather Considerations in Demolition Projects

Wellington's weather can be quite unpredictable, with strong winds and considerable rainfall throughout the year. Therefore, demolition experts need to be prepared for various weather conditions that might impact their work. For instance, prolonged bad weather may require the use of protective covers or temporary structures to safeguard the site. Similarly, frosty conditions can cause machinery to malfunction, leading to delays. A seasoned demolition professional will account for these variables when planning the project timeline, providing a more accurate and reliable schedule.
